I wonder if that witness, Susannah, could be a sister to William?
There is a Susannah Perry living With her mum at Cross Road, Waste, Oldswinford, in 1841:
1841 at Cross Road, Waste, Oldswinford
Elizabeth Perry 65 Nailor
James Perry 25 Nailor
Susanna Perry 20
Diana Perry 15
Meshack Perry 15
All born in county.
and with her husband, John Bashford at Waste Bank Wollescote in 1851. Her mother, Elizabeth Perry is with them:
1851 at Waste Bank, Wollescote
John Bashford Head 30 Horse Nail Maker b. Worcs., Lye
Susannah Bashford Wife 30 Nail Forger b. Worcs., Lye
Matilda Bashford Daur 4 Scholar b. Worcs., Lye
Elizabeth Perry Mother-in-law W 76 Pauper formerly Nail Forger b. Worcs., Oldswinford
There is this Extracted IGI entry on LDS:
name: Susanna Perry
baptism/christening date: 13 Aug 1820
baptism/christening place: OLD SWINFORD,WORCESTER,ENGLAND
father's name: William Perry
mother's name: Elizabeth
Could William b. abt 1808 be the son of William & Elizabeth Perry? I can't find a birth/baptism entry.
